Job description

Your Responsibilities

The Structural / Civil Designer serves as a subject matter expert and design lead responsible for developing and supporting structural designs for KSPC. The role involves collaborating with Engineering, Production, and Project teams to create detailed design solutions, ensure compliance with industry standards, and support project execution. The designer manages third-party design resources, overseeing external contractors and consultants to ensure alignment with company standards, project requirements, and regulatory guidelines. Additionally, the role includes coordinating between internal teams and external technical resources, reviewing third-party designs, and providing technical oversight to ensure seamless project execution. The designer also plays a key role in maintaining and improving infrastructure by producing accurate drawings, assisting with design reviews, and supporting standardized design and maintenance practices for structural assets.

  • Lead structural design reviews with internal stakeholders and external engineering firms to ensure constructability, compliance with KSPC standards, and cost-effectiveness.
  • Champion standardization and continuous improvement of structural detailing, drafting libraries, and drawing quality.
  • Drive technical alignment across external engineering partners to ensure clarity in scope and minimize rework.
  • Mentor junior designers or drafters and support knowledge transfer across the team.
  • Interface with Project Engineering teams to support structural scope development and evaluation of third-party bids.
  • Conduct constructability, maintainability, and operability reviews based on site experience and field input.
  • Develop and prepare detailed structural steel and concrete designs and drawings using AutoCAD, AVEVA E3D, or other relevant software.
  • Work closely with engineers and project teams to create structural layouts, models, and technical documentation.
  • Review and interpret engineering specifications, design standards, and project requirements.
  • Ensure all designs comply with applicable building codes, mining safety regulations, and KSPC internal standards.
  • Coordinate with internal teams and external consultants to ensure design accuracy and project alignment.
  • Manage third-party design resources by reviewing deliverables, providing feedback, and enforcing compliance with project objectives and quality expectations.
  • Assist with structural assessments, inspections, and design modifications for existing infrastructure, integrating findings into updated drawings and standards.
  • Support the management-of-change (MOC) process by delivering timely structural design solutions for maintenance and brownfield project work.
  • Participate in multidiscipline design reviews and provide recommendations for safety, reliability, and cost optimization.
  • Perform detailed drafting and design tasks across multiple disciplines when required to ensure cohesive, clash-free brownfield integration.
  • Conduct periodic site visits to verify existing conditions, validate designs, engage stakeholders, and document field findings for continuous improvement.

Your Profile

Our company values and recognizes the diversity of the workforce and encourages individuals with the equivalent combination of education and work experience. The ideal candidate will have:

  • Diploma or technical program in CAD/CAM Engineering Technology, Engineering Design and Drafting Technology, or a related field.
  • 10+ years of progressive experience in structural/civil design in heavy industrial or mining environments (potash preferred).
  • Advanced knowledge of Canadian building codes (NBC, CSA S16, A23.3) and structural detailing standards.
  • Proficiency in AVEVA E3D, Autodesk Civil 3D, Revit, Plant 3D, Navisworks, and related modeling software.
  • Experience reviewing and managing deliverables from EPCs, consultants, or third-party design service providers.
  • Strong leadership and communication skills with the ability to lead design reviews, influence external stakeholders, and uphold owner engineering interests.
